2. Letters That Look Familiar But Sound Different

The trickiest part of Cyrillic is that some letters look like English letters but make completely different sounds:

Cyrillic Looks Like Actually Sounds Like
Н н H N (as in "no")
Р р P R (rolled)
С с C S (as in "sun")
В в B V (as in "very")
У у Y OO (as in "food")

4. The Ukrainian Х Sound

The letter Х makes a sound that doesn't exist in English - it's like the "ch" in Scottish "loch" or German "Bach." It's a soft, breathy sound from the back of the throat.

6. Tips for Learning Cyrillic

  1. Start with familiar letters: А, О, Т, К, М look and sound similar to English.
  2. Learn the "false friends" next: Focus on letters that look like English but sound different (Н, Р, С, В).
  3. Practice with real words: Don't just memorize the alphabet - learn words right away.
  4. Write by hand: Writing helps cement the letter shapes in your memory.
  5. Be patient: Most learners can read slowly within a week of practice.
